The City Council unanimously approved a resolution recognizing Jan. 30 as Fred Korematsu Day, honoring the civil‑rights legacy of the Japanese‑American activist and the broader history of wartime incarceration of Japanese Americans. The council cited local ties and the Korematsu Center at UC Irvine.

The Irvine City Council adopted a resolution on Oct. 14 recognizing Jan. 30 as Fred Korematsu Day of Civil Liberties and the Constitution.
